cheniere building two facilities, in louisiana and another one in corpus christi, texas.ey're talking about the permitting process, as well as the contracts they're signing to sell liquefied natural gas once the terminals are up and running. i've been behind the stock for ages, lng's given me a quick 25% gain since we last spoke to the ceo six months ago. let's check in with the visionary chairman and ceo, find out about where his company's doing and where it's headed. welcome back to "mad money." good to see you. >> thank you. >> have a seat. >> thank you. >> when we first heard about the kremlin in kiev, it was pretty clear that the media kind of didn't understand. because they know we have a lot of natural gas. they figure, you put it on a ship and send it there. doesn't work like that, does it? >> i wish. no, it takes many years to really, first, plan it and organize it properly. at least two to three years in the planning process. and then, if you have a good set and prepared carefully, it takes another four to five years to get your first lng. >> you're talking abou

we got an exclusive look inside one of the other five test ranges at texas a & m university in corpus christiresearchers are wrestling with all kind of issues as to how to safely integrate drones into u.s. air space and what they might be best used for, some hurdles they're tackling, how can drones stay away from other aircraft, address privacy issues. almost every drone has a camera on board. an a danger the drone's gps navigation system could be hacked and the drone sent off course. texas a & m university says that is a big concern. >> if it was in a very populated area, obviously if it's a long drone and someone brings it down it could cause a lot of damage or harm. and we certainly don't want that to happen. >> the researchers say in order to avoid that the civilian gps system may need to be hardened, encrypted like the military system so it can't be hacked, bill? >> besides search and rescue, john, what are some of the other uses for drones we'd find? >> initially the researchers say applications far away from populated centers. crop surveys, for example, checking out transmission lines
